The line at the top of the screen would look like forum > parent support forum > site help and resources > board abbreviations/acronyms IEP isn't from this site though. It stands for individual education plan and is from the schools. It is a legal document that says where your kid is now, the goals you kid has, and how the school is going to help your kid met those goals. It is put together by a team of people that includes you.
